What's in the feed now

Tax year 2023 — spent $29,118 more than it took in. Revenue $121,054 · expenses $150,172 · reserve months 2.4
Tax year 2022 — spent $49,179 more than it took in. Revenue $103,122 · expenses $152,301 · reserve months 4.6
Tax year 2021 — took in $18,908 more than it spent. Revenue $45,210 · expenses $26,302 · reserve months 52.1
Tax year 2020 — took in $1,159 more than it spent. Revenue $21,905 · expenses $20,746 · reserve months 55.1
Tax year 2019 — took in $5,120 more than it spent. Revenue $22,737 · expenses $17,617 · reserve months 64.1
Tax year 2018 — took in $6,446 more than it spent. Revenue $114,823 · expenses $108,377 · reserve months 9.9
Tax year 2017 — spent $7,258 more than it took in. Revenue $131,100 · expenses $138,358 · reserve months 7.2
Tax year 2016 — took in $1,316 more than it spent. Revenue $86,631 · expenses $85,315 · reserve months 12.6
Tax year 2015 — took in $419 more than it spent. Revenue $129,056 · expenses $128,637 · reserve months 8.3
Tax year 2014 — took in $11,429 more than it spent. Revenue $101,072 · expenses $89,643 · reserve months 11.8
Tax year 2013 — took in $10,891 more than it spent. Revenue $142,658 · expenses $131,767 · reserve months 7.1
Tax year 2012 — took in $21,780 more than it spent. Revenue $110,074 · expenses $88,294 · reserve months 9.0
Tax year 2011 — took in $18,954 more than it spent. Revenue $137,911 · expenses $118,957 · reserve months 4.0
Tax year 2010 — took in $9,180 more than it spent. Revenue $18,905 · expenses $9,725 · reserve months 12.4
